Who are the members of the international club?

Tatsuyoshi Miyakoshi and Kenichi Suzuki

Applied Economics, 2014, vol. 46, issue 14, 1582-1585

Abstract: This article proposes pragmatic methods that incorporate recent contributions to public good theory to identify the members of the international club and how they select new members. This article also suggests simple applications to the recent problems in international clubs such as the euro and NATO.
